Why Hinoki Wood Is Used For Sushi Plates In Japan
Hinoki cypress has been used in Japanese kitchens for generations. Lightweight, naturally antibacterial and gentle on food, it is particularly valued for serving sushi and sashimi.
Its pale color and subtle aroma enhance presentation without affecting flavor, making it one of Japan’s most respected culinary woods.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is a sushi platter used for?
A sushi platter is used to serve and present sushi in a structured way that maintains freshness and highlights each piece.
Why use a wooden sushi plate?
Wood absorbs excess moisture, protects delicate ingredients and offers a more traditional sushi presentation than ceramic plates.
What is Hinoki wood?
Hinoki is a Japanese cypress valued for its durability, subtle fragrance and natural antibacterial properties.
Is Hinoki wood safe for food?
Yes. Hinoki has been used for centuries in Japan for sushi serving, cutting boards and other food-related applications.
How do you care for a wooden sushi platter?
Rinse gently with water, avoid soaking, and allow it to dry completely. Do not place in a dishwasher.

Care & Warnings
- Hand wash only, avoid dishwashers
- Do not soak for long periods
- Dry fully before storage to prevent warping
- Keep away from direct heat or sunlight
- Oil lightly with food-safe mineral oil if needed to maintain wood quality
